File baselibs.conf of Package A_sr-Mesa

101
 
1
Mesa
2
    # Include this special README file so dummy Mesa-<targettype> gets
3
        # build and other arch packages can supplement it.
4
    +/usr/share/doc/packages/Mesa/README.package.*
5
    # Must require the base Mesa package to get /etc/drirc configuration file.
6
    requires "Mesa = <version>"
7
    obsoletes "XFree86-Mesa-<targettype> xorg-x11-Mesa-<targettype>"
8
    provides  "XFree86-Mesa-<targettype> xorg-x11-Mesa-<targettype>"
9
    provides "Mesa-libIndirectGL1-<targettype> = <version>"
10
    obsoletes "Mesa-libIndirectGL1-<targettype> < <version>"
11
    requires "libglvnd-<targettype> >= 0.1.0"
12
    requires "Mesa-dri-<targettype> = <version>"
13
    requires "Mesa-gallium-<targettype> = <version>"
14
15
Mesa-devel
16
    #We need Mesa-<targettype>!, do not put requires -Mesa-<targettype>.
17
    requires "Mesa-<targettype> = <version>"
18
    requires "Mesa-libEGL-devel-<targettype> = <version>"
19
    requires "Mesa-libGL-devel-<targettype> = <version>"
20
    requires "Mesa-libGLESv1_CM-devel-<targettype> = <version>"
21
    requires "Mesa-libGLESv2-devel-<targettype> = <version>"
22
    requires "Mesa-libIndirectGL-devel-<targettype> = <version>"
23
    requires "libgbm-devel-<targettype> = <version>"
24
    requires "libglvnd-devel-<targettype> >= 0.1.0"
25
    obsoletes "XFree86-Mesa-devel-<targettype> xorg-x11-Mesa-devel-<targettype>"
26
    provides  "XFree86-Mesa-devel-<targettype> xorg-x11-Mesa-devel-<targettype>"
27
    obsoletes "Mesa-libIndirectGL-devel-<targettype> < <version>"
28
    provides "Mesa-libIndirectGL-devel-<targettype> = <version>"
29
30
Mesa-libEGL1
31
    requires "libglvnd-<targettype> >= 0.1.0"
32
Mesa-libEGL-devel
33
    requires "Mesa-libEGL1-<targettype> = <version>"
34
        # Mesa-KHR-devel contains only header files, so no -<targettype> variant
35
    requires "Mesa-KHR-devel = <version>"
36
    requires "libglvnd-devel-<targettype> >= 0.1.0"
37
Mesa-libGL1
38
    requires "Mesa-<targettype> = <version>"
39
    requires "libglvnd-<targettype> >= 0.1.0"
40
Mesa-libGL-devel
41
    requires "Mesa-libGL1-<targettype> = <version>"
42
        # Mesa-KHR-devel contains only header files, so no -<targettype> variant
43
    requires "Mesa-KHR-devel = <version>"
44
    requires "libglvnd-devel-<targettype> >= 0.1.0"
45
Mesa-libGLESv1_CM-devel
46
    requires "Mesa-libEGL-devel-<targettype> = <version>"
47
        # Mesa-KHR-devel contains only header files, so no -<targettype> variant
48
    requires "Mesa-KHR-devel = <version>"
49
    requires "libglvnd-devel-<targettype> >= 0.1.0"
50
Mesa-libGLESv2-devel
51
    requires "Mesa-libEGL-devel-<targettype> = <version>"
52
        # Mesa-KHR-devel contains only header files, so no -<targettype> variant
53
    requires "Mesa-KHR-devel = <version>"
54
    requires "libglvnd-devel-<targettype> >= 0.1.0"
55
Mesa-libGLESv3-devel
56
    requires "Mesa-libEGL-devel-<targettype> = <version>"
57
        # Mesa-KHR-devel contains only header files, so no -<targettype> variant
58
    requires "Mesa-KHR-devel = <version>"
59
libgbm1
60
libgbm-devel
61
    requires "libgbm1-<targettype> = <version>"
62
Mesa-libd3d
63
    provides "d3dadapter9.so.1"
64
Mesa-libd3d-devel
65
    requires "Mesa-libd3d-<targettype> = <version>"
66
libvulkan_intel
67
    targetarch aarch64 +/usr/share/vulkan/icd.d/intel_icd.*.json
68
    targetarch aarch64 +/usr/share/vulkan/icd.d/intel_hasvk_icd.*.json
69
    targetarch ppc64 +/usr/share/vulkan/icd.d/intel_icd.*.json
70
    targetarch ppc64 +/usr/share/vulkan/icd.d/intel_hasvk_icd.*.json
71
    targetarch ppc64le +/usr/share/vulkan/icd.d/intel_icd.*.json
72
    targetarch ppc64le +/usr/share/vulkan/icd.d/intel_hasvk_icd.*.json
73
    targetarch x86_64 +/usr/share/vulkan/icd.d/intel_icd.*.json
74
    targetarch x86_64 +/usr/share/vulkan/icd.d/intel_hasvk_icd.*.json
75
    requires "Mesa-vulkan-device-select-<targettype> = <version>"
76
    provides  "Mesa-libVulkan-devel-<targettype> = 22.0.0"
77
    obsoletes "Mesa-libVulkan-devel-<targettype> < 22.0.0"
78
libvulkan_nouveau
79
    targetarch aarch64 +/usr/share/vulkan/icd.d/nouveau_icd.*.json
80
    targetarch x86_64 +/usr/share/vulkan/icd.d/nouveau_icd.*.json
81
    requires "Mesa-vulkan-device-select-<targettype> = <version>"
82
libvulkan_radeon
83
    targetarch aarch64 +/usr/share/vulkan/icd.d/radeon_icd.*.json
84
    targetarch ppc64 +/usr/share/vulkan/icd.d/radeon_icd.*.json
85
    targetarch ppc64le +/usr/share/vulkan/icd.d/radeon_icd.*.json
86
    targetarch x86_64 +/usr/share/vulkan/icd.d/radeon_icd.*.json
87
    requires "Mesa-vulkan-device-select-<targettype> = <version>"
88
libvdpau_nouveau
89
libvdpau_r600
90
libvdpau_radeonsi
91
libvdpau_virtio_gpu
92
Mesa-vulkan-device-select
93
Mesa-vulkan-overlay
94
Mesa-dri-vc4
95
Mesa-dri-nouveau
96
Mesa-dri
97
    supplements "Mesa-<targettype> = <version>"
98
Mesa-gallium
99
    supplements "Mesa-<targettype> = <version>"
100
Mesa-libva
101